Alec was a beloved son, brother, grandson, family member and friend.
Those who knew Alec, even just a little, lost a young man with a kind heart. As a mother writing her son's obituary, you don't really want to talk about your child's struggles with addiction, but it is real and it is life. He most recently was on the right path to overcoming his addiction, and for that we are so very proud and thankful.
Alec was born April 24, 1991, and will be missed by his mother and step father, Charlyn and Chris Bright; his grandfather, Chuck Nimmo; his brother, Jon; his little fishing buddy, Colton Nimmo; and a very special man that was always there for him and never gave up on him, his great uncle Doyle Nimmo.
Even though he left this world to early we are thankful he is in heaven with his grandmother Carolyn and great-grandmother Velma.
Alec's services will be held at a later date and he will be laid to rest at McGee Chapel where he spent many a day caring for the grounds and always had a sense of peace while being there, and we know he is now at peace.
As a parent hug your children and tell them you love them as you never know if that will be the last.
